ADEN-SABA
Minister of Industry and Trade Dr. Mohammed al-Ashwal chaired a meeting of the Joint Committee on Public-Private Partnership in Aden to discuss practical reforms aimed at improving the business and investment environment ahead of their submission to the Cabinet.
The meeting, attended by government officials and private sector representatives, reviewed key regulatory and operational challenges facing businesses, explored policy and legislative reforms, examined investment opportunities, and discussed measures to strengthen institutional coordination.
Dr. al-Ashwal emphasized that closer government-private sector cooperation is a national priority and a cornerstone of economic reform. He called for streamlined procedures, an improved investment climate, and the swift preparation of a unified reform agenda to enhance the business environment, facilitate trade and supply chains, and encourage private sector investment.
